Skip to main content

Constants, definitions, and generically useful tools used by CASM

Project description

Shows the CASM logo

libcasm-global

The libcasm-global package provides generically useful tools used by CASM:

  • CASM global constants and definitions
  • Input / output tools, especially for JSON parsing and formatting
  • An Eigen distribution and methods using Eigen
  • Helpers for runtime library compiling and linking
  • Miscellaneous mathematical functions
  • Other tools for C++ development

Install

pip install libcasm-global

Usage

See the libcasm docs.

About CASM

The libcasm-global package is part of the CASM open source software package, which is designed to perform first-principles statistical mechanical studies of multi-component crystalline solids.

CASM is developed by the Van der Ven group, originally at the University of Michigan and currently at the University of California Santa Barbara.

For more information, see the CASM homepage.

License

GNU Lesser General Public License (LGPL). Please see the file LICENSE for details.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

libcasm_global-2.4.0.tar.gz (1.8 MB view details)

Uploaded Source

Built Distributions

If you're not sure about the file name format, learn more about wheel file names.

libcasm_global-2.4.0-cp314-cp314-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l (2.1 MB view details)

Uploaded CPython 3.14manylinux: glibc 2.27+ x86-64manylinux: glibc 2.28+ x86-64

libcasm_global-2.4.0-cp314-cp314-manylinux_2_26_aarch64.manylinux_2_28_aarch64.whl (2.1 MB view details)

Uploaded CPython 3.14manylinux: glibc 2.26+ ARM64manylinux: glibc 2.28+ ARM64

libcasm_global-2.4.0-cp314-cp314-macosx_11_0_arm64.whl (1.9 MB view details)

Uploaded CPython 3.14macOS 11.0+ ARM64

libcasm_global-2.4.0-cp313-cp313-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l (2.1 MB view details)

Uploaded CPython 3.13manylinux: glibc 2.27+ x86-64manylinux: glibc 2.28+ x86-64

libcasm_global-2.4.0-cp313-cp313-manylinux_2_26_aarch64.manylinux_2_28_aarch64.whl (2.1 MB view details)

Uploaded CPython 3.13manylinux: glibc 2.26+ ARM64manylinux: glibc 2.28+ ARM64

libcasm_global-2.4.0-cp313-cp313-macosx_11_0_arm64.whl (1.9 MB view details)

Uploaded CPython 3.13macOS 11.0+ ARM64

libcasm_global-2.4.0-cp312-cp312-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l (2.1 MB view details)

Uploaded CPython 3.12manylinux: glibc 2.27+ x86-64manylinux: glibc 2.28+ x86-64

libcasm_global-2.4.0-cp312-cp312-manylinux_2_26_aarch64.manylinux_2_28_aarch64.whl (2.1 MB view details)

Uploaded CPython 3.12manylinux: glibc 2.26+ ARM64manylinux: glibc 2.28+ ARM64

libcasm_global-2.4.0-cp312-cp312-macosx_11_0_arm64.whl (1.9 MB view details)

Uploaded CPython 3.12macOS 11.0+ ARM64

libcasm_global-2.4.0-cp311-cp311-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l (2.1 MB view details)

Uploaded CPython 3.11manylinux: glibc 2.27+ x86-64manylinux: glibc 2.28+ x86-64

libcasm_global-2.4.0-cp311-cp311-manylinux_2_26_aarch64.manylinux_2_28_aarch64.whl (2.1 MB view details)

Uploaded CPython 3.11manylinux: glibc 2.26+ ARM64manylinux: glibc 2.28+ ARM64

libcasm_global-2.4.0-cp311-cp311-macosx_11_0_arm64.whl (1.9 MB view details)

Uploaded CPython 3.11macOS 11.0+ ARM64

libcasm_global-2.4.0-cp310-cp310-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l (2.1 MB view details)

Uploaded CPython 3.10manylinux: glibc 2.27+ x86-64manylinux: glibc 2.28+ x86-64

libcasm_global-2.4.0-cp310-cp310-manylinux_2_26_aarch64.manylinux_2_28_aarch64.whl (2.1 MB view details)

Uploaded CPython 3.10manylinux: glibc 2.26+ ARM64manylinux: glibc 2.28+ ARM64

libcasm_global-2.4.0-cp310-cp310-macosx_11_0_arm64.whl (1.9 MB view details)

Uploaded CPython 3.10macOS 11.0+ ARM64

File details

Details for the file libcasm_global-2.4.0.tar.gz.

File metadata

  • Download URL: libcasm_global-2.4.0.tar.gz
  • Upload date:
  • Size: 1.8 MB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.1.0 CPython/3.13.5

File hashes

Hashes for libcasm_global-2.4.0.tar.gz
Algorithm Hash digest
SHA256 d8397bbf328b220148d6e60e538a215721e64958a95a64f5e70bed1db458c3af
MD5 1aa78c2003e2ac7e65fe7ce58ec83607
BLAKE2b-256 4fab64aaebbc5d8a04a04062c2c5d78ac2dffaf11c82f6455b76c2f8a7e4c0fb

See more details on using hashes here.

File details

Details for the file libcasm_global-2.4.0-cp314-cp314-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l.

File metadata

File hashes

Hashes for libcasm_global-2.4.0-cp314-cp314-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l
Algorithm Hash digest
SHA256 ad22959200ff8587da56234fdf29092b56ad2fe301686e781127ce601cf411d7
MD5 c34c8f12ff6a2fb8bb64a9d03fcf8853
BLAKE2b-256 5505ae45ff6a46be599227627927acae9845815e6ed0faf45bed0214c475ee03

See more details on using hashes here.

File details

Details for the file libcasm_global-2.4.0-cp314-cp314-manylinux_2_26_aarch64.manylinux_2_28_aarch64.whl.

File metadata

File hashes

Hashes for libcasm_global-2.4.0-cp314-cp314-manylinux_2_26_aarch64.manylinux_2_28_aarch64.whl
Algorithm Hash digest
SHA256 f093ed38ba3032acda9f331dc6435952512b66e4c08ae37e7a4f3422f8c0b27a
MD5 9393c3f8aa5e1e26e47bd05a960c12b2
BLAKE2b-256 f247359cfa4fc6e2a23a006612a4271e12616c01e5bb29f0f0c1214e427585e6

See more details on using hashes here.

File details

Details for the file libcasm_global-2.4.0-cp314-cp314-macosx_11_0_arm64.whl.

File metadata

File hashes

Hashes for libcasm_global-2.4.0-cp314-cp314-macosx_11_0_arm64.whl
Algorithm Hash digest
SHA256 ff4138068a9c5243b6d2e3076430d6f5111f8ad1baf4f47f097a98168b263b37
MD5 b109680e4efad2250b5e0dad928982dd
BLAKE2b-256 7afb92ba2e985148901df8d159ced65add9d65df74f8c0417bdf0589df8dbeef

See more details on using hashes here.

File details

Details for the file libcasm_global-2.4.0-cp313-cp313-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l.

File metadata

File hashes

Hashes for libcasm_global-2.4.0-cp313-cp313-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l
Algorithm Hash digest
SHA256 512d53cfa743a6ee2d3ca4a3a3aa9a21e7edb63feb2cde8aac0a3cec686fef78
MD5 0d7d96aee2759d6bd643d97d6808aa9f
BLAKE2b-256 babfc6f382f73540f84895655b4ce17a9e399f00c3b8cd1f45297485a67759dd

See more details on using hashes here.

File details

Details for the file libcasm_global-2.4.0-cp313-cp313-manylinux_2_26_aarch64.manylinux_2_28_aarch64.whl.

File metadata

File hashes

Hashes for libcasm_global-2.4.0-cp313-cp313-manylinux_2_26_aarch64.manylinux_2_28_aarch64.whl
Algorithm Hash digest
SHA256 ff53c3499a3f66cc53c987fed87019d9a4fbfffe1c60b53b58a9a6b804405bdb
MD5 b88ddaa747f0dd6986f19e43fcfefddd
BLAKE2b-256 c7e43cdefebdada11184ec0cb63403fac072c81ca662c1fb1336e67cce54e360

See more details on using hashes here.

File details

Details for the file libcasm_global-2.4.0-cp313-cp313-macosx_11_0_arm64.whl.

File metadata

File hashes

Hashes for libcasm_global-2.4.0-cp313-cp313-macosx_11_0_arm64.whl
Algorithm Hash digest
SHA256 2641ae91c4c55471d5b9d011a1b1fbe91c1ef6b8372203111fc0108be7e2d055
MD5 edf8df28f08891e34b63609074f0b262
BLAKE2b-256 24636a1cf98a54c0744def953324d3fc1e7b875721634d7b3f3ec6d2655ef085

See more details on using hashes here.

File details

Details for the file libcasm_global-2.4.0-cp312-cp312-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l.

File metadata

File hashes

Hashes for libcasm_global-2.4.0-cp312-cp312-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l
Algorithm Hash digest
SHA256 5c0505c371bd9510427070c0f107ec164b2a383912d8f00c2f445268b36fd998
MD5 3ec4e0e363663e7dd204fae24686eaf6
BLAKE2b-256 3fe0adccc7f15fd3a385ef95637f1723c287a9c91ddb2262fdb62f22b7251cc0

See more details on using hashes here.

File details

Details for the file libcasm_global-2.4.0-cp312-cp312-manylinux_2_26_aarch64.manylinux_2_28_aarch64.whl.

File metadata

File hashes

Hashes for libcasm_global-2.4.0-cp312-cp312-manylinux_2_26_aarch64.manylinux_2_28_aarch64.whl
Algorithm Hash digest
SHA256 7cf10c0cbf32e4dfd2cc86b02ce1d8bde2b03f87e3caa94b484e3a48880c6262
MD5 e3de5fac88b040e169c5e33b4a990ae8
BLAKE2b-256 49acc042f0d142a5327ec4fa231e4110d3d36a3a9acaccef05885482a05a5997

See more details on using hashes here.

File details

Details for the file libcasm_global-2.4.0-cp312-cp312-macosx_11_0_arm64.whl.

File metadata

File hashes

Hashes for libcasm_global-2.4.0-cp312-cp312-macosx_11_0_arm64.whl
Algorithm Hash digest
SHA256 56357169138146a18d50e08b659b73ac0c22114dfd005c7647bf6682cd4d766d
MD5 4998882c6723a87b8c2780f0fdc0a81d
BLAKE2b-256 ca48444ebf6e833c510165ba70898cd8222c89d12406fc11acef19c9c05b4fe8

See more details on using hashes here.

File details

Details for the file libcasm_global-2.4.0-cp311-cp311-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l.

File metadata

File hashes

Hashes for libcasm_global-2.4.0-cp311-cp311-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l
Algorithm Hash digest
SHA256 5f62a8856a4064485d926c9f66532dbc114568a8c2bcafab9617110e6b371645
MD5 438795f63449022d74564841d1f1bc6e
BLAKE2b-256 42938fe6235f721e483f66762018ed8f4f076f2116f1723bb0fc9424dad959ff

See more details on using hashes here.

File details

Details for the file libcasm_global-2.4.0-cp311-cp311-manylinux_2_26_aarch64.manylinux_2_28_aarch64.whl.

File metadata

File hashes

Hashes for libcasm_global-2.4.0-cp311-cp311-manylinux_2_26_aarch64.manylinux_2_28_aarch64.whl
Algorithm Hash digest
SHA256 5e276ddbc0ad78f68942e29ba078f412450d6a368b2186224a761fb18201a8d1
MD5 113808bafb124aef2460e776cb42e480
BLAKE2b-256 b951e29b56db312ef9efa2d41ec6745e64cc3fd3a2294f43283d93b0f7114427

See more details on using hashes here.

File details

Details for the file libcasm_global-2.4.0-cp311-cp311-macosx_11_0_arm64.whl.

File metadata

File hashes

Hashes for libcasm_global-2.4.0-cp311-cp311-macosx_11_0_arm64.whl
Algorithm Hash digest
SHA256 b21c0a0e626ce929342748dae53ef411eb81d4c1b41631b387b1123e6261dff9
MD5 09f9801a8d357337a2e1aefdaf99ca5d
BLAKE2b-256 4675bce2668e16a1201ea54eef98b2977727967c8eb3daf46ccbfdde59f78bec

See more details on using hashes here.

File details

Details for the file libcasm_global-2.4.0-cp310-cp310-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l.

File metadata

File hashes

Hashes for libcasm_global-2.4.0-cp310-cp310-manylinux_2_27_x86_64.manylinux_2_28_x86_64.whl
Algorithm Hash digest
SHA256 2f0d5e14550fa1ed02d27a725d4022916948fcfd999d8c9df95f10ed216880be
MD5 e5c69c86ec4158542fc443fbaa230b5b
BLAKE2b-256 07546440055917df4fafe3461f4d43d678bc72366c5facfd13a9b083b60af937

See more details on using hashes here.

File details

Details for the file libcasm_global-2.4.0-cp310-cp310-manylinux_2_26_aarch64.manylinux_2_28_aarch64.whl.

File metadata

File hashes

Hashes for libcasm_global-2.4.0-cp310-cp310-manylinux_2_26_aarch64.manylinux_2_28_aarch64.whl
Algorithm Hash digest
SHA256 bdaa20f0d888a24e5494a215ec8d76b2f4ff6a6dc287bf97b9787fc4eb0552bc
MD5 18f43cd5b15762d88c0bd1cf97956b77
BLAKE2b-256 7d042aaacb129c391a83da94907295f78efc946b4cbecfccbe150180ffe6305c

See more details on using hashes here.

File details

Details for the file libcasm_global-2.4.0-cp310-cp310-macosx_11_0_arm64.whl.

File metadata

File hashes

Hashes for libcasm_global-2.4.0-cp310-cp310-macosx_11_0_arm64.whl
Algorithm Hash digest
SHA256 054ca967e8e5fa21948d80155a127e7c3a3eb6a145a32c14cdc0cba70a441015
MD5 6d875fe1cb5eb0db202ed08c8e833b66
BLAKE2b-256 61e6902a2d91529641bebd6d5cb42162582997d42e9689d0bdbfbe9af290a5fb

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page